Councils raise concerns over voter ID

23 June 2023
Councils raise concerns over voter ID
The Local Government Association has responded to an Electoral Commission review into Voter ID which found that 14,000 people were unable to vote due to new voter ID requirements.
The review also found that some groups were more affected than others.

New Home Office hub in Stoke-on-Trent

23 June 2023
New Home Office hub in Stoke-on-Trent
Home Secretary Suella Braverman has opened a new Home Office hub in Stoke-on-Trent which is set to create five hundred new jobs.
The new office has been created thanks to £7 million of funding from Stoke-on-Trent’s £56 million allocation through the Levelling Up Fund.
The site will be used for a new Asylum Casework Hub which is intended to significantly speed up asylum decision-making by improving case working capacity and efficiency.

UK marks 75 years of the Windrush Generation

22 June 2023
UK marks 75 years of the Windrush Generation
22 June marks 75 years since the MV Empire Windrush arrived in the UK.
Educational, arts and sporting projects and activities are being held across the UK to promote community cohesion and understanding of the Windrush story.
45 community projects across the UK are being funded by the £750,000 Windrush Day Grant Scheme. This includes cricket matches held at the Sheffield Caribbean Sports Club and a procession celebrating the Windrush generation from Clapham Common to Brixton’s Windrush Square.

New scheme encourages graduates into town and planning careers

22 June 2023
New scheme encourages graduates into town and planning careers
The Department for Levelling Up is awarding £1.59 million to a Local Government Association scheme to help councils recruit and develop more skilled planners.
The Pathways to Planning Programme will place graduates in councils. Around 30 people will be able to secure a placement while also receiving a bursary to study towards a planning masters.
